Here are some of the best AI robo-advisor platforms:
- **{{[[Betterment]]:https://www.businessinsider.com/personal-finance/investing/best-robo-advisors}}**: Known for being cost-effective and trustworthy, offering a diverse selection of securities, automatic rebalancing, tax-loss harvesting, and personalized retirement plans. It charges 0.25% to 0.65% annually depending on the service level[1][3][4].
- **{{[[Vanguard Digital Advisor]]:https://investor.vanguard.com/advice/robo-advisor}}**: Offers high-quality portfolio construction with a low $100 minimum investment. It provides tax-loss harvesting and financial planning tools, making it a top choice for retirement savings[2][6].
- **{{[[Fidelity Go]]:https://www.fidelity.com/}}**: Ideal for budget investors, with no fees for balances under $25,000. It offers a streamlined experience and invests in Fidelity Flex mutual funds with zero expense ratios[2][5].
- **{{[[Wealthfront]]:https://www.wealthfront.com/}}**: Best for diversification, offering a wide range of investment options and financial planning tools[1][3].
- **{{[[Schwab Intelligent Portfolios]]:https://www.schwab.com/intelligent-portfolios}}**: Known for low fees and solid investments, with automatic tax-loss harvesting. It offers a digital-only service with no management fee[3][4].

**Google AI Answer (with Grounding):**
Saving money requires discipline and planning. Here's a concise summary of effective strategies:
**Budgeting & Goal Setting:**
* Create a detailed budget tracking income and expenses. Identify areas for reduction.
* Set specific, realistic savings goals (short-term and long-term). This provides motivation.
**Automatic Savings:**
* Automate transfers from checking to savings accounts on payday. This ensures consistent saving.
* Take advantage of employer-sponsored retirement plans (401k) and automatic contributions.
**Spending Reduction:**
* Distinguish between needs and wants. Delay non-essential purchases.
* Pack lunches, cook at home more often, and reduce eating out.
* Lower energy consumption (adjust thermostat, turn off lights).
* Review and cancel unused subscriptions (streaming services, apps).
* Use coupons, cash-back apps, and loyalty programs.
* Explore cheaper entertainment options (library, free community events).
* Negotiate lower rates on loans (auto, mortgage) if possible.
* Pay credit cards in full each month to avoid interest charges.
**Additional Tips:**
* Build an emergency fund (3-6 months of living expenses).
* Use the "30-day rule" for impulse purchases.
* Pay yourself first—treat savings like a bill.
* Take advantage of salary increases to boost savings.
* Consider a "no-spend month" periodically.
By implementing these strategies, you can effectively save money and achieve your financial goals. Remember that consistency and planning are key.

## Leading AI Portfolio Management Platforms
{{[[Mezzi]]:https://www.mezzi.com/blog/best-ai-for-portfolio-management}} : Mezzi is an AI-powered platform designed for personal and family investment portfolio management, offering real-time insights, cross-account aggregation, and advanced tools like the X‑Ray feature to uncover hidden stock exposures and risks. Users benefit from unlimited AI chat for personalized advice and conservative, data-driven return projections[1].
{{[[Kavout]]:https://visualping.io/blog/ai-investment-research-tools}} : Kavout leverages machine learning and predictive analytics to provide stock scoring, portfolio optimization, risk assessment, and backtesting. It is geared toward investment professionals and quantitative analysts seeking data-driven equity research and factor-based portfolio construction[2].
{{[[Bloomberg Terminal]]:https://lynkcm.com/ai-tools-portfolio-management-and-financial-advisory}} : Bloomberg Terminal integrates AI into its analytics and monitoring tools, delivering real-time financial data, news, and insights for institutional portfolio managers and financial advisors[3].
{{[[Alphasense]]:https://lynkcm.com/ai-tools-portfolio-management-and-financial-advisory}} : Alphasense uses natural language processing to search and analyze financial documents and news, providing timely market intelligence for investment research and decision-making[3].
{{[[Sentieo]]:https://lynkcm.com/ai-tools-portfolio-management-and-financial-advisory}} : Sentieo offers an AI-enhanced financial research platform that helps users track companies, analyze trends, and improve research efficiency with advanced search and analytics capabilities[3].
{{[[QuantConnect]]:https://lynkcm.com/ai-tools-portfolio-management-and-financial-advisory}} : QuantConnect is a platform for algorithmic trading and portfolio management, enabling users to backtest, develop, and deploy AI-driven trading strategies across multiple asset classes[3].
{{[[Wealthfront]]:https://www.nerdwallet.com/best/investing/robo-advisors}} : Wealthfront is a leading robo-advisor that automates portfolio management using algorithms, offering features like automatic rebalancing, tax optimization, and low fees for hands-off investors[6].
## Key Features and Use Cases
- **Automation & Optimization**: Platforms like {{[[Mezzi]]}}, {{[[Kavout]]}}, and {{[[Wealthfront]]}} use AI to automate portfolio construction, rebalancing, and tax optimization, reducing manual effort and human bias[1][2][6].
- **Advanced Analytics**: {{[[Bloomberg Terminal]]}}, {{[[Alphasense]]}}, and {{[[Sentieo]]}} provide deep market analytics, real-time data, and NLP-powered research tools for institutional and professional users[3].
- **Algorithmic Trading**: {{[[QuantConnect]]}} enables quantitative analysts to build, test, and deploy AI-driven trading strategies at scale[3].
- **Risk Management**: AI tools across these platforms enhance risk assessment, exposure analysis, and adaptive portfolio adjustments in response to market changes[1][2][4].
